Elements Influencing Cat Flap Installation Costs
The costs associated with installing a cat flap installation guarantee flap can vary substantially due to several aspects. Understanding these components will help pet owners make informed decisions. Here are the crucial factors affecting prices:
Type of Cat Flap: Different types of cat flaps come with differing price points. Fundamental models cost less, while innovative electronic flaps that control gain access to might cost more.
Product of the Door: The material of the door where the cat flap will be installed (wood, PVC, glass, or metal) can affect installation costs. For circumstances, glass installation frequently needs specific tools and proficiency, raising the price.
Location & & Accessibility: The ease of access to the installation website can affect expenses. If the area is difficult to reach or needs additional labor (such as cutting through walls or rearranging existing components), this can contribute to the total cost.
Installer's Experience: Professional cat flap installers come with various levels of experience and competence. Hiring a seasoned professional might involve greater labor expenses, but it could cause a more effective installation.
Permits and Regulations: Depending on local policies, authorizations might be required for certain types of setups, particularly in rental residential or commercial properties or historical homes. This can increase expenses.
Sample Price List for Cat Flap Installers
To supply a clear photo of the prospective expenses included in cat flap installation, here's a sample catalog. Keep in mind that these are typical prices and can vary based on area and installer rates:
Service/TypeTypical Price (₤)DescriptionBasic Cat Flap (standard)100 - 150Easy installation of a manual cat flap into wooden/drywall.Electronic Cat Flap200 - 300Installation of a microchip or RFID-enabled cat flap.Glass Cat Flap250 - 400Installation of a cat door fitting flap in glass panels (requires competence).PVC or Metal Door Installation150 - 250Installation in front or back entrances made of PVC or metal.Extra Modifications50 - 150Includes required adjustments to existing door frames.Emergency Installation200 - 350For immediate requests, prices can increase substantially.Travel Charges (if applicable)20 - 50Depend upon distance from the installer's base.Additional Costs and Considerations

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. The length of time does it require to install a cat flap?
The installation procedure usually takes between 1 and 2 hours, depending on the type of flap and the intricacy of the installation.
2. Can I set up a cat flap myself?
Yes, numerous house owners pick to install cat flaps themselves, particularly for simpler designs. Nevertheless, if your door is made of glass or requires considerable modifications, it's best to consult a professional.
3. Is there a specific area in my house that's best for a cat flap?
The ideal area is frequently a back entrance or side door that supplies simple access to your outdoor space. Prevent high-traffic areas to reduce the chances of mishaps.
4. What if my cat declines to use the flap?
It may require time for your cat to season to the flap. Favorable reinforcement, such as treats and encouragement, can help. In addition, think about speaking with a veterinarian if the behavior continues.
5. Are electronic cat flaps worth the investment?
For many pet owners, electronic cat flaps use included security and convenience, especially for multi-pet households. They can avoid undesirable animals from entering the home, which might validate the greater cost.
